Hi Chris , Only 2 remote keys. ( I cant recall a plastic one, I will have to check my spare key and see if anything else is on the keyring)

You can check the registered keys on the dash via the DIS. i.e 1 of 2, 2 of 2. etc,.

Alright Chris, long time no see. Believe ours (55 plate) came with two switchblade keys and the plastic wallet key that contains the code number to create a new key if required. This is sometimes slotted down the spline of the big wallet that your books come in, worth a double check.

Bad news on the mat, ours had no rears, believe they were actually optional when new, managed to haggle them to be chucked in
